BENNINGTON COLLEGE CORPORATION, founded in 1932, is a mid-sized nonprofit in the Education sector that reported $90.8M in total revenue in fiscal year 2024.

Mission

A LIBERAL ARTS EDUCATIONAL INSTITUTION IN BENNINGTON, VT WITH 800 STUDENTS ENROLLED.
